The Governments of Nunavut and Canada Co-chair the Canadian Council of Fisheries and Aquaculture Ministers’ Meeting
Media advisory
Iqaluit, Nunavut – The Minister of Community Services for Nunavut, the Honourable David Akeeagok, and the federal Minister of Fisheries, the Honourable Joanne Thompson, will co-chair a meeting of the Canadian Council of Fisheries and Aquaculture Ministers (CCFAM). Topics to be discussed include: advancement and collaboration of Canada’s economic priorities within the fish and seafood sector, sustainable fisheries management, aquaculture, and managing aquatic invasive species. A media availability with the co-chairs will conclude the CCFAM meetings.
